Opening hours

Rancho's Taqueria - Opening hours

Currently closed
Monday
07:00-22:00
Tuesday
07:00-22:00
Wednesday
07:00-22:00
Thursday
07:00-22:00
Friday
07:00-23:00
Saturday
07:00-23:00
Sunday
07:00-22:00

Restaurants in Houston open now

4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 2800 Kirby Drive Suite A100TX 77098, Houston, United States
"Incredible service of jose. eating was excellent."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 415 WestheimerTX 77006, Houston, United States
"Our server, Madeline, was awesome! Food was excellent!"
4.8
Menu
Open Now
4.8
Menu
Open Now
City: Houston, 5 Greenway Plz, Houston I-77046-0526, United States
"I recently had one of the best burgers I have ever tasted at Greenway Plaza's food court. My wife and I were pleasantly surprised by how delicious the..."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 902 Capitol St, Houston, TX 77002, United States
"Great place. Beverages, Service and Prices"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 2010 Waugh Dr, Houston, United States Of America
"Super funny and great customer service"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 1517 Alabama St, Houston, United States
"We visited Axelrad for a beer and were pleasantly surprised by its size; it's much bigger than we anticipated. The outdoor area is expansive, complete..."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 4500 Washington Avenue, Houston, TX 77007, United States
"Very fresh and very friendly. Liberal with their servings ;"
4.8
Menu
Open Now
4.8
Menu
Open Now
City: Houston, 6412 N Main St, Houston I-77009-1754, United States
"My husband and I visited on a Friday night at 6 PM, and unfortunately, we had trouble finding parking. I ordered the Mai Tai and the Space City Painki..."
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: Houston, 6320 N Main St, Houston I-77009-2435, United States
"Food excellent, the favor was on point"
4.8
Menu
Open Now
4.8
Menu
Open Now
City: Seabrook (near Houston), 4622 E Nasa Pkwy, Seabrook, United States
"This is my favorite lunch spot in the area. Having lived in Thailand for two years, I can confidently say that this restaurant offers authentic, genui..."